Chemical Constituents In The Stem Of Yunnan Traditional Medicine Lonicera Acuminata

This thesis is composed of two chapters.The chemical constituents from stems of Lonicera acuminata Wall.are investigated in chapter one.The chemical constituents were isolated by MCI,Sephadex LH-20,silica gel and Rp-18 column chromatographic methods.Their chemical structures were elucidated by physical and chemical propeties,chromatergraph and spectral data.Twenty-five compounds were istated and identified from the medicinal plants mentioned above,including 2 new compounds.Structural type of these compounds involved iridoids,triterpenoids,phenylpropanoids,steroids,flavones and aliphatic acids,et al.The second chapter providesa more comprehensive overview of Lonicera acuminata Wall.from medica evolution,plant resources,chemical composition,pharmacological activity and clinical and pharmaceutical applications.Due to the difference in plant resources,the source of traditional Chinese medicine for Lonicera japonicum used in Yunnan is different from the Chinese Pharmacopoia,and it is mainly used as the Lonicera japonica with dry stes of Lonicera acuminata Wall.So far,the research on “Rendongteng” is mainly concentrated in the Lonicrea japoraca Thunb.,but the research on the chemical constituents of the Lonicera acuminata Wall.is less,especially the report of the chemical constituents.To date,only one part of the research is in the flower,and the chemical composition of the stems has not been repored.The effective components and mechanisms of action are indistinct.In order to clarify the material basis of Lonicera acuminata Wall.,It will pave the way for future research on the mechanism of action of effective ingredients,the chemical constituents in the stem of Lonicera acuminata Wall.is carried.Twenty-five compoun-ds were istated and identified from the dried stems of the medicinal mentioned.Among them,6'-(4-hydroxy-3,5-dimethoxy-benzoyl)sweroside(1),8-glucopyranosyldiosmetin(2)were the new compounds,6'-(4-hydroxy-3,5-dimethoxy-benzoyl)sweroside(1),8-glucopyranosyldiosmetin(2),strychnovline(7),lariciresinol(10),9?-hydroxypinoresinol(12),11,12,15-trihydroxy-13-en-oc-tadecenoic acid(17),1-methylcyclopentene(22),seven comounds were isolated from the genus Lonicera Linn.for the first time,6'-(4-hydroxy-3,5-dimethoxybenzoyl)sweroside(1),8-glucopyranosyldiosmetin(2),loganin(3),vogeloside(4),secologanin dimethylacetal(5),7-epi-vogeloside(6),loganic acid(7),strychnovline(8),sweroside(9),(+)-pinoresinol-4-O-?-Dglucopyranoside(11),transethyl caffeate(13),caffeic acid(14),protcatechuic acid methylester(15),luteolin(16),(2E,6S)-8-[?-L-arabinopyranosyl(1 "?6')-?-D-glucopyranosyloxy]-2,6-dimethyloct-2-eno-1,2"-lactone(18),hederagenin(19),oleanolicaci(20),1-methylcyclopentene(22),n-tridecane(24),triacontane(25)were isolated from this plants for the first time.The second chapter provide a more comprehensive overview of Lonicera acuminata Wall.from medica evolution,plant resources,chemical composition,pharmacolgical activity and clinical and pharmaceutical applications to provide a reference for further research and development.
